WASHINGTON — The National Association of Manufacturers announced that Melanie Cook, chief operating officer, GE Appliances, a Haier company, has been named to the NAM Board of Directors.

Founded in 1895, the NAM is the largest industrial trade association in the United States with 14,000 members.

The NAM’s membership includes some of the world’s most iconic brands and many of the small manufacturers that power the U.S. economy. More than 90% of its members are small and medium-sized businesses.

“I am honored to be a part of the NAM Board and continue to fight for policies that will ensure our continued growth and success as manufacturers,” said Cook. “Washington, D.C., needs to understand how their policies affect the more than 12 million men and women employed in manufacturing. I look forward to sharing my story and my experiences—and the stories of all manufacturers—to strengthen our economy and create more opportunities for working families.”
